What is paje-dbg

paje-dbg is:

The libpaje library features the implementation of the Paje File Reader, Event Decoder and Simulator. It is capable of reading trace files in the Paje file format and keeping them in memory. Data is accessed through a well-defined and efficient interface. You can use this library to built new visualization techniques for trace analysis, without handling all the parsing of files and how events are simulated to rebuilt the behavior of the traced application that is meant to be analyzed.

This package contains detached debugging symbols for the package pajeng and for the library libpaje.

There are three methods to install paje-dbg on Ubuntu 18.04. We can use apt-get, apt and aptitude. In the following sections we will describe each method. You can choose one of them.

Install paje-dbg Using apt-get

Update apt database with apt-get using the following command.

sudo apt-get update

After updating apt database, We can install paje-dbg using apt-get by running the following command:

sudo apt-get -y install paje-dbg

Install paje-dbg Using apt

Update apt database with apt using the following command.

sudo apt update

After updating apt database, We can install paje-dbg using apt by running the following command:

sudo apt -y install paje-dbg
